| Fund Overview | The Fund is a long/short investment fund principally investing in listed entities, commodities, futures and options in Australia and internationally. The Fund is not a market neutral fund and accordingly may switch between net long positions and net short positions. The Fund may use short sales and derivatives. Gearing may be used to enhance returns and the Fund may be geared in excess of 100% of the Fund's Net Asset Value. There is a limit to net exposure of 150%. |
| Manager Comments | The Up and Down Capture ratios are notable at 1.6 and -0.50 respectively. The current market setup is potentially favourable for a nimble long short manager. We have the possibility of QE ending in the USA next month, volatility is so low at present that the risk from here is more than likely to the upside and corporate activity (such as IPO's, placements) is still very strong. with events such as the IPO of Medibank (due to list before xmas) capable of moving the performance needle for a small fund like ours. Top contributors to performance in August were our long positions in McMillan Shakespeare +1.13% & Intueri Education +0.94% (scarce growth). Index Futures positions also contributed +1.00%. Biggest detractors from performance were our long positions in Fortescue Metals -0.76% (deleveraging), Mint Wireless -0.69% (cashless society) & Henderson Group -0.34% (financial services). |
